I have just learned today that the thing I was referring to is not making it
into the product (at least not now). The "thing" is a sample devised by DAE
that uses WS and JavaScript to do some very clever dynamic updating of HTML
forms (including a grid that behaves like a data entry table). I'd like to
build this technology into my web classes when I'm ready.
